一种基于浏览器的网页课件演示辅助系统及方法

文档序号:6539339阅读:219来源:国知局
一种基于浏览器的网页课件演示辅助系统及方法
【专利摘要】本发明公开了一种基于浏览器的网页课件演示辅助系统及方法,涉及网页课件演示辅助【技术领域】。本发明包括原始课件数据层、演示背景层、内容显示层、演示功能层和用户交互层五个层;采用了对浏览器窗口分层显示方式,主要利用了网页脚本语言、flash、多层(Div)结构和框架(Frame)结构实现网页课件的文字缩放、图片缩放、页面标记、背景变换、翻页动画、黑/白屏等演示辅助功能。优点:使网页格式课件的演示达到与常用的Powerpoint等专门演示软件相近的效果。
【专利说明】一种基于浏览器的网页课件演示辅助系统及方法
【技术领域】
[0001]本发明涉及网页课件演示辅助【技术领域】,具体是一种基于浏览器的网页课件演示辅助系统及方法。
【背景技术】
[0002]在教学、培训、会议等活动中演讲者利用配备投影仪或大屏显示终端的计算机展示演讲内容的应用已十分普遍,PowerPoint、WPS演示等办公软件因其具备卓越的编辑、演示等功能而倍受欢迎,此类软件为人们带来了一定便利的同时也存在以下不足:(1)多媒体资源整合较为繁琐,插入和播放其中的音频、视频、动画等多媒体资源严重受到计算机平台的制约;(2)网络化效果不够理想,PowerPoint, WPS演示网络化运行速度和演示效果远不及单机模式;(3)兼容性问题难以预料,常因制作软件与演示软件版本不同而引起演示文件在演示计算机上无法打开。网页格式数据能够将文字、图片、视频、音频和动画等各种多媒体资源有机整合,随着计算机网络技术的不断发展普及,网页浏览器已成为计算机常备软件,因此网页格式课件在兼容性和共享性方面具有很大优势,特别是借助网络服务器及网络连接极易实现异地共享及各种环境的演示。目前已有一定量的课件采用了网页格式,但由于普通网页数据在浏览器中显示时不具备页面实时标记等演示辅助功能,因此其演示的交互性有限。

【发明内容】

[0003]针对以上问题,本发明的一种基于浏览器的网页课件演示辅助系统及方法,能够实现基于浏览器的网页格式课件的演示辅助,实现特效翻页、页面标记,图像缩放等功能,使网页格式课件的演示达到与常用的Powerpoint等专门演示软件相近的效果。
[0004]本发明是以如下技术方案实现的:一种基于浏览器的网页课件演示辅助系统,包括原始课件数据层、演示背景层、内容显示层、演示功能层和用户交互层五个层;
a、原始课件数据层加载本地或网络课件内容,并保持在浏览器显示窗口中为隐藏状
态;
b、演示背景层用于加载和显示课件背景图片,在浏览器显示窗口中处于最底层;
C、内容显示层显示经脚本处理函数对原始课件数据层中内容进行格式修改、添加标签等处理后的数据,该层数据的显示受控于演示控制脚本,响应交互层中用户操作,该层在浏览器显示窗口中处于演示背景层上方。
[0005]d、演示功能层以较高但不完全透明的方式呈现于课件内容显示层上方,通过flash或javascript实业页面标记、翻页特效、黑/白屏转换等演示辅助功能;
e、用户交互层提供命令工具按钮,用户通过操作这些按钮来调用相应的脚本程序,从而控制显示内容及效果。
[0006]一种基于浏览器的网页课件演示辅助方法,利用了网页脚本语言、flash、多层结构和框架结构实现网页课件的文字缩放、图片缩放、页面标记、背景变换、翻页动画、黑/白屏等演示辅助功能,具体步骤如下:
1)系统加载来自本地或网络的网页格式课件文件到原始课件数据层中作为源数据;
2)系统利用脚本处理代码对源数据进行一定的处理后以一定形式在内容显示层中呈
现;
3)交互层接收用户对课件的操作与控制命令并通过调用相应代码控制内容显示层中数据或演示功能层中相应功能。
[0007]其进一步是:所述步骤3)中内容显示层显示对原始课件经脚本处理后的内容,其数据显示受控于演示控制脚本,响应交互层操作。
[0008]本发明有益效果是:实现基于浏览器的网页格式课件的演示辅助,实现特效翻页、页面标记,图像缩放等功能,使网页格式课件的演示达到与常用的Powerpoint等专门演示软件相近的效果。
【专利附图】

【附图说明】
[0009]下面结合附图及实施例对本发明作进一步说明。
[0010]图1是本发明系统原理框图。
【具体实施方式】
[0011]如图1所示,一种基于浏览器的网页课件演示辅助系统,包括原始课件数据层、演示背景层、内容显示层、演示功能层和用户交互层五个层。
[0012]原始课件数据层加载本地或网络课件内容,并保持在浏览器显示窗口中为隐藏状态。
[0013]演示功能层以较高但不完全透明的方式呈现于课件内容显示层上方,通过flash或javascript实现页面标记、翻页特效、黑/白屏转换等演示辅助功能。
[0014]演示背景层用于加载和显示课件背景图片,在浏览器显示窗口中处于最底层(Z-1ndex 最小)。
[0015]内容显示层显示经脚本处理函数对原始课件数据层中内容进行格式修改、添加标签等处理后的数据,该层数据的显示受控于演示控制脚本,响应交互层中用户操作,该层在浏览器显示窗口中处于演示背景层上方。
[0016]交互层提供命令工具按钮,用户通过操作这些按钮来调用相应的脚本程序,从而控制显示内容及效果。
[0017]各层采用Frame和Div进行组织,每层根据功能需要置入相应的脚本代码。
[0018]一种基于浏览器的网页课件演示辅助方法,系统采用了对浏览器窗口分层显示方式,主要利用了网页脚本语言、flash、多层(Div)结构和框架(Frame)结构实现网页课件的文字缩放、图片缩放、页面标记、背景变换、翻页动画、黑/白屏等演示辅助功能,具体步骤如下:
O系统加载来自本地或网络的网页格式课件文件到原始课件数据层中作为源数据;
2)系统利用脚本处理代码对源数据进行一定的处理后以一定形式在内容显示层中呈
现;
3)交互层接收用户对课件的操作与控制命令并通过调用相应代码控制内容显示层中数据或演示功能层中相应功能。
[0019]所述步骤3 )中内容显示层显示对原始课件经脚本处理后的内容,其数据显示受控于演示控制脚本,响应交互层操作。
【权利要求】
1.一种基于浏览器的网页课件演示辅助系统,其特征在于,包括原始课件数据层、演示背景层、内容显示层、演示功能层和用户交互层五个层; a、原始课件数据层加载本地或网络课件内容,并保持在浏览器显示窗口中为隐藏状态; b、演示背景层用于加载和显示课件背景图片,在浏览器显示窗口中处于最底层; C、内容显示层显示经脚本处理函数对原始课件数据层中内容进行格式修改、添加标签等处理后的数据,该层数据的显示受控于演示控制脚本,响应交互层中用户操作,该层在浏览器显示窗口中处于演示背景层上方; d、演示功能层以较高但不完全透明的方式呈现于课件内容显示层上方,通过flash或javascript实业页面标记、翻页特效、黑/白屏转换等演示辅助功能; e、用户交互层提供命令工具按钮,用户通过操作这些按钮来调用相应的脚本程序,从而控制显示内容及效果。
2.根据权利要求1所述的一种基于浏览器的网页课件演示辅助方法,其特征在于:利用了网页脚本语言、flash、多层结构和框架结构实现网页课件的文字缩放、图片缩放、页面标记、背景变换、翻页动画、黑/白屏等演示辅助功能,具体步骤如下: O系统加载来自本地或网络的网页格式课件文件到原始课件数据层中作为源数据; 2)系统利用脚本处理代码对源数据进行一定的处理后以一定形式在内容显示层中呈现; 3)交互层接收用户对课件的操作与控制命令并通过调用相应代码控制内容显示层中数据或演示功能层中相应功能。
3.根据权利要求2所述的一种基于浏览器的网页课件演示辅助方法,其特征在于:所述步骤3 )中内容显示层显示对原始课件经脚本处理后的内容,其数据显示受控于演示控制脚本,响应交互层操作。
【文档编号】G06F9/44GK103823684SQ201410076241
【公开日】2014年5月28日 申请日期:2014年3月4日 优先权日:2014年3月4日
【发明者】焦富强, 乔卉莹 申请人:徐州工业职业技术学院
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1